Dad Edits Cat Into Famous Movie Scenes And The Clips Are Hilarious.

There’s no shortage of cute cats on the internet, but the newest feline sensation has something all the others lack: movie credits.

While Lizzy, a black long-haired rescue cat who goes by the stage name OwlKitty, may not have an IMDB page set up just yet, she’s already collecting fans and followers all over the web thanks to her appearance in dozens of Hollywood-style movie trailers and memes.

OwlKitty lives with her owners Thibault Charroppin and Olivia Boone, a pair of creative types who call Portland, Oregon their home. According to their website, Thibault is a filmmaker, animator, “Photoshop wizard, and “lifelong #catdad.” Olivia is a creative writer and content editor. Together they’ve come up with a fun way to enjoy their cats Lizzy and Juliette while also turning them into a viral sensation.

“We started making ‘Owl Kitty’ videos about six months ago just to entertain ourselves and it really took off,” Thibault explained. “At first it was just a way for us to combine our shared interests,” added Olivia. “Thibault is an animator and a filmmaker and I’m a writer, and we just wanted to make something really funny.”

Olivia and Thibault spend hours posing OwlKitty, so nicknamed because of her resemblance to an owl with those huge greenish-yellow eyes, in front of a green screen. Thibault then uses his digital editing skills to insert the cat into a variety of amusing situations and movie scenes.

Olivia and Thibault make sure the experience is fun for their little furry diva by giving her lots of treats throughout the creative process. Her favorite is tuna fish, but she’ll work for just about any tasty morsel you offer her. What a pro!

To date, OwlKitty has been the star of such blockbuster hits as “Star Wars: A New Hope,” “Jurassic World,” “Game of Thrones,” “Friends,” and many more. Each video is more amusing than the last, and she’s managed to find her way into a lot of current events and news stories as well.

“Lizzy (stage name: OwlKitty) is a two year-old cat living in Portland, Oregon. She stars in all your favorite movies and tv shows and gets lots of treats and cuddles in return,” the couple wrote on their website. “Offscreen, Lizzy loves her laser pointer, her adoptive mother Juliette (a 10 year-old tabby) and the taste of cream cheese. She’s never caught a bird.”
